South Korea Advances CGMP Support for Global Cosmetic Industry
The South Korean government is effectively boosting its cosmetic industry’s global competitiveness. The 2025 Cosmetic GMP Activation Support Project is set to enhance the country’s capacity for quality management in cosmetic manufacturing, aiming to increase K-beauty exports systematically.
Supporting Global Standards for K-Beauty
The Ministry of Food and Drug Safety has announced key initiatives, including tailored expert consulting and specialist training. This also includes the creation of training video content, initiatives that are crucial as South Korean companies gear up for the U.S. market, where stringent GMP standards are applied to sunblock products treated as Over-the-Counter (OTC) medications.
The strategy aligns with South Korea’s broader commitment to smart factory development under the “Department Collaboration Smart Factory Construction Support Project.” This project supports the use of Information and Communication Technology (ICT) to streamline production, ultimately improving product quality.

Case Study: Establishing a CGMP-Compliant Future
The benefits of CGMP support are evident in case studies from the industry: 2023 saw Korean Beauty Co,’s market expansion facilitated by CADevelopment’s SmartFactory Solutions, accelerating their entry into the European market.
Earlier programs starting in 2016 laid foundations that have now enabled over 60 companies to be officially recognized as GMP-compliant by the Ministry. In recent years, specialist training sessions have totaled over 31 occasions, involving over 2,000 participants.
